AbstractThe Dalai Lama is one of the most renowned and beloved spiritual leaders in the world. In this small book, intended to speak to everyone, both Buddhist and non-Buddhist alike, he simply and clearly addresses the concerns of modern life.
In the volume, His Holiness describes how to bring love and compassion into our daily lives. He explores the fundamentals of the Buddha's teaching, from basic advice on how to love more fully to the importance of compassion.
